BAGS, NOT BACKPACKS PLEASE
Please replace the backpacks 

The children's teachers like to help them learn independence.  The children can easily put away all their artwork and papers when they can reach into the top of a bag hanging on a hook. The bag with one big opening holds lots of artwork. Unzipping a backpack makes the task much more difficult.  Also those multiple pockets make it easy for papers to get lost going between teacher and parents.

I LOVE YOU RITUAL FOR MARCH

Hot Cross Buns traditionally eaten hot or toasted during Lent
Hot Cross Buns

Hot Cross Buns, Hot Cross Buns        

Clap thighs, hands, child's hands

 One penny, Two penny                    

Touch 1 finger right hand, 2 fingers left hand

Hot Cross Buns

Clap thighs, hands, child's hands

Give them to your daughters   

Shake right hands

Give them to your sons 

Shake left hands

One penny, Two penny 

Repeat finger touches

Hot Cross Buns   

Clap thighs, hands, child's hands

 
Those of you who have come to Conscious Discipline sessions know how important it is to build connections with eye contact, touch and presence in a playful way.  Teachers do these with your children and they do them with each other.  You can build connections in your child's brain by doing these together at home.
